Selecting the Appropriate Estate Succession Lawyer in SLC
Navigating inheritance succession can be challenging, especially in this area. Picking the ideal property arrangement attorney is essential to securing your loved ones’ future. Start by obtaining referrals from acquaintances or looking online for seasoned professionals. Consider factors like their expertise in property law, a cost structure, and the track record. Don't hesitate to arrange appointments with several counsels to find someone you connect with.

Selecting an Succession Planning Lawyer in SLC Recommendations
Navigating estate planning can be complex , and finding the ideal experienced counsel is essential. Salt Lake City offers website a range of skilled professionals, but which do you proceed? Evaluate these factors when making your selection: Expertise in succession law, particularly with local nuances is key . Client reviews and endorsements provide valuable insight. In addition , know the fee structure. We advise exploring these alternatives:
- Peruse online profiles and assessments on sites like Avvo and Martindale-Hubbell.
- Ask for multiple consultations to discuss your requirements .
- Question about their method to estate planning and whether or not they specialize in your particular scenario.
